Precision cnc machining and processing of high precision mechanical parts

For the production of high precision mechanical parts after the passage from the lathe machines it may be necessary to rectify an additional treatment of the grinding components. This adjustment allows you to also eliminate the last residues of material and to obtain a component conforms exactly to the project.
On high-precision cnc machining parts can be performed so additional processing to further improve the surface of the component. After washing the components in tanks of solvents, which are used to clean the material from all impurities, you can proceed, for example, the burnishing or nickel plating. The T.M.G. It performs at the request of high precision mechanical parts treatments to ensure a perfect finish of the components, as in the medical or hydraulic industry.

In pressurized circuits hydraulics the perfect calibration of the components is a prerequisite to ensure the watertight integrity of every detail and also the processing of materials is carefully evaluated to ensure reliable assemblies.

The precision cnc machining of high precision mechanical parts therefore not only limited to the realization of the structural part of the component but requires complex operations which give the original material in a high capacity for endurance of workloads can occur over time. Only when all the stages of preparation of the component respond to the fulfillment of the requirements in the design phase will start production of the component in the guarantee of an excellent quality standard

All the possibilities of precision mechanics: discovering PTFE

Massively used  in precision mechanics, Teflon is the trade name of polytetrafluoroethylene (PTFE), a polymer belonging to the class of perfluorocarbons, which are added other stabilizing components and thinners to improve the application possibilities.Teflon is the trade name of polytetrafluoroethylene (PTFE), a polymer belonging to the class of perfluorocarbons, which are added other stabilizing components and thinners to improve the application possibilities.

It is the material with the lower coefficient of friction known and has a considerable resistance towards external agents, a high degree of non-stick properties and resistance to low and high temperatures (from -200 ° C to + 260 ° C). It is therefore considered one of the most stable plastics materials from the thermal point of view, great to be worked in the cnc precision mechanics also.
The PTFE was discovered accidentally by Roy Plunkett in 1938, during an attempt to manufacture a chlorofluorocarbon for use as refigerante for the compression cycles.

Some of Teflon characteristics, such as the total chemical inertia (which is not attacked by chemical compounds, except that of the alkali metals in the molten state, high-pressure fluorine and some of its compounds), the complete insolubility in water and organic solvents , the fire resistance, over wing surface smoothness and all’antiaderenza, make it indispensable in precision mechanics for gaskets and the parts intended for contact with corrosive agents, in the engines, to reduce the friction of the exchange, for vehicle windscreen wipers, as insulating material and for many other uses in the mechanical, computer and food.
